Discover LudwigThe phrase "address technical problems" is correct and usable in written English.
You can use it when discussing the need to solve or manage issues related to technology or technical systems.
Example: "The IT department was called in to address technical problems that were affecting the network's performance."
Alternatives: "resolve technical issues" or "tackle technical challenges".
